Pasta with Romanesco and Spicy Tomato Sauce
Ingredients
- 200 grams pasta - I used conchiglie
- 1 head of Romanesco cut into florets
- 2 cloves garlic finely sliced
- Handful of Parmesan cheese
- Extra Virgin Olive Oil
- 2 tablespoons tomato paste
- 1 good pinch of chili flakes
Boil your pasta according to instructions and set aside. In a wok or large pan, on low heat, add enough E.V.O.O. (ha I'm so Rachel Ray!) to coat the bottom of your pan. Add garlic and chili flakes. When the garlic is tender add your romanesco and heat it for about 2 minutes.
Add salt and pepper, a dash of water and two tablespoons of tomato paste to the pan. When the alien veggie is nice and tender add the pasta and Parmesan and heat through.
